For the FareLoom pricing experiment, plugins must not assume a fixed discount ceiling; the experiment service recomputes bounds per cohort every hour. Your plugin should read the active bounds from the context object rather than hardcoding values observed in staging, since the Merrowgate staging cluster runs a compressed schedule. Rounding is always applied after your adjustment, never before. The constants governing cohort assignment and bound recomputation are listed here for reference.

constants for tageg-kagag:
QUOTAS = {
    "kelax": 495,
    "istath": 366,
    "tammir": 108,
    "novdor": 730,
    "casax": 816,
    "quenael": 874,
    "pelius": 403,
}

Capacity note for eng sync — Switchloom rollouts. Flag evaluations in the Switchloom framework are cheap, but rollout changes fan out to every connected SDK, and our push tier saturates around 250k clients per region. Staggered propagation keeps the spike manageable; full convergence currently takes under 40 seconds at p99. As Bramwell's team onboards next quarter, we expect connected clients to double, so we're pre-provisioning two more push nodes per region. Current propagation behavior is governed by the following constants:

tuning table, faduf-baduf:
PRIORITIES = {
    "ulavan": 191,
    "silys": 750,
    "goriel": 238,
    "kelmir": 66,
    "wendor": 432,
}

Step 6 covers releasing Shrinkbatch, our batch image resizing CLI. Build the static binary on the Ashgrove runner, run the smoke suite against the sample corpus, then tag the release. Distribution through the Pellworth package channel requires a signed manifest. The channel's deploy key for this quarter is listed below.

deploy key for kajof-yawif: bky9_fvxrpdHPq

Sandboxing user formulas in CalcNest — quick rundown. Any formula a user types gets parsed, then evaluated inside the Hermit sandbox: no filesystem, no network, 50ms CPU cap, memory ceiling enforced by the runner. If the sandbox trips, we log and return a generic error — never echo the formula back. Escapes are treated as sev-1; page the Hollis crew immediately and freeze formula evaluation tenant-wide. Full escape-response procedure and past incident writeups are on the internal page linked below.

wiki page, bagaf-fawip: https://harbor.tolvaqsys.local/pages/repo/pages/secrets/eac969ffc71f356b